An Introduction Gold IRA Rollover

gold IRA Rollover guide It is essential to know the basics of IRA rollover before making the decision to move funds from an 401(k) into the gold IRA. A gold IRA is a retirement account that permits the investors to make investments in silver, gold, along with other valuable metals. This kind of retirement account offers many benefits, including tax-deferred growth possibilities and the ability to diversify your portfolio by investing in an actual asset. In order to begin a 401(k) to gold IRA transfer, you have to first create an account with a custodian who specializes in investments made with gold. Once you have your account set up you should contact the company managing the account in your 401(k) to initiate your transfer. It is important to note that some 401(k) plans do not allow direct investments in physical precious metals, so it is crucial to confirm with the plan administrator before making the rollover.

Tax implications of rolling over Your 401(k) into a Gold IRA

When you transfer funds from a 401(k) into an gold IRA There are some important tax implications to consider. In general, when funds are rolled over from a 401(k) into an IRA there are no tax or penalties are incurred. However, if the funds are taken from the 401(k) and deposited directly to the gold IRA, taxes and penalties might be charged. It is important to check with a tax professional who is qualified to determine if any taxes or penalties are due. Additionally, it is important to know that the IRS requires that all funds held within the Gold IRA must be stored at an approved custodian and must be held in a form that is IRS-approved, such as coins and bars. Failure to adhere to these rules could lead to penalties as well as other consequences.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Making an Gold IRA Rollover

When you are performing a Gold IRA rollover, it is crucial to be aware of common mistakes that could cause fees, taxes and other issues. The most crucial points to be aware of is that funds should be transferred directly from the old account to the new in order to avoid taxes If the funds are taken out and later deposited, it will be taxed. Another error to avoid is to not update your beneficiaries. When transferring accounts, make sure that your beneficiaries are current. It is also crucial to be familiar with all fees associated with the new account, as well as the restrictions or demands they may need to meet to keep it open. Take your time and research thoroughly before committing to a particular company or investment; this will guarantee that you get the best possible deal for your hard-earned cash.
